6.4 Receive Mode Register
Receive Mode Register: 16-bit write-only. C-BUS address $E2
This register controls the CMX869 receive signal type and level.
All bits of this register are cleared to 0 by a General Reset command or when b7 (Reset) of the General
Control Register is 1.

Rx Mode Register b15-12: Rx mode
These 4 bits select the receive operating mode.
b15 b14 b13 b12
1 1 1 x Reserved, do not use
1 1 0 1 Reserved, do not use
1 1 0 0 V.22, V.22 bis, V.32, V.32 bis QAM modem
1 0 1 x Reserved, do not use
1 0 0 1 V.21 300 bps FSK

0 0 0 1 DTMF, Programmed tone pair, Answer Tone, Call Progress detect
0 0 0 0 Receiver disabled
Rx Mode Register b11-9: Rx level
These three bits set the internal gain of the Rx Gain Control block.
